Gurjaani (გურჯაანი, usually found in English as Gurjaani on signposts etc.) is a district town in the Alasanital (Kakheti).

background
The area around Gurjaani was already settled in the Stone Age. The oldest churches in the area date from the 8th century. Gurdschaani is - like the rest of the Alasanital - an important wine-growing region. The modern city was founded and expanded in 1934.

Tourist Attractions
![](http://upload.wikimedia.org/wikipedia/commons/thumb/1/1c/Watschnadsiani,sw.jpg/220px-Watschnadsiani,sw.jpg)
All Saints Church of Watschnadsiani
- 1 Gurdschaanis Kwelazminda (All Saints Church Gurdschaani)გურჯაანის ყველაწმინდა: The basilica was built in the 7th century with two domes over the middle of the three aisles, a three-church basilica and a gallery. Detailed information about architecture and history on Wikipedia.
- 2 Watschnadsianis Qwelazminda (All Saints Monastery of Watschnadsiani)ვაჩნაძიანის ყველაწმინდა: The Mother of God Church (9th century) with its complex architecture combines a three-church basilica and a central building with a high dome. Following the example of Watschnadsiani, classical Georgian church architecture developed from the 11th century.

- 3 Sanagire Monastery : Desolate monastery with a three-aisled basilica made of brick and hewn stone (10th-11th centuries) and a single-nave medieval basilica. Ruins of the monastery building and the enclosure wall. A hundred meters northeast of the monastery, the ruins of the Sanagire cloverleaf chapel (სანაგირის ტეტრაკონქი / Sanagiris Tetrakonki).
activities
![](http://upload.wikimedia.org/wikipedia/commons/thumb/b/b6/Kakheti._Akhtala_muds.jpg/220px-Kakheti._Akhtala_muds.jpg)
Akhtala medicinal mud
- 1 Akhtala health resort The is located directly to the west of the city of Gurjaani Akhtala health resortახტალა, engl. Akhtala). The mineral-rich mud is used for medical and therapeutic purposes. The mineral spring was discovered in 1924 and from 1932 a small sanatorium and the spa clinic were opened.
